Main Prem Ki Diwani Hoon (2003) is a romantic musical drama that has shifted from a box-office disappointment to a legendary "cult classic" of unintentional comedy. Director: Sooraj Barjatya (his first film without Salman Khan as the lead).
Cast: Hrithik Roshan (Prem Kishen), Kareena Kapoor (Sanjana), and Abhishek Bachchan (Prem Kumar). Origin: A modern remake of the 1976 classic Chitchor.
Budget vs. Box Office: Produced for ~₹24 crore, it earned ~₹39 crore worldwide but was declared a commercial failure in India. 💎 Deep Features & Trivia
The "Overacting" Legend: The film is famous for the extremely high-energy performances of Hrithik Roshan and Kareena Kapoor, which have since become a goldmine for internet memes and "reaction" videos. NZ for India:
Though set in the fictional Indian town of "Sunder Nagar," it was actually filmed in New Zealand (Auckland, Queenstown, Christchurch) and .
CGI Companions: It featured a CGI parrot named Raja and a CGI dog, which were considered ambitious (if slightly jarring) for Bollywood at the time.
